60 | Not all machines support hardware-driven error report. Some of those | |
61 | provide a BIOS-driven error report mechanism via ACPI, using the | |
62 | APEI/GHES driver. By enabling this option, the error reports provided | |
63 | by GHES are sent to userspace via the EDAC API. | |
64 | ||
65 | When this option is enabled, it will disable the hardware-driven | |
66 | mechanisms, if a GHES BIOS is detected, entering into the | |
67 | "Firmware First" mode. | |
68 | ||
69 | It should be noticed that keeping both GHES and a hardware-driven | |
70 | error mechanism won't work well, as BIOS will race with OS, while | |
71 | reading the error registers. So, if you want to not use "Firmware | |
72 | first" GHES error mechanism, you should disable GHES either at | |
73 | compilation time or by passing "ghes.disable=1" Kernel parameter | |
74 | at boot time. | |
75 | ||
76 | In doubt, say 'Y'. | |

85 | When EDAC_DEBUG is enabled, hardware error injection facilities |
86 | through sysfs are available: | |
87 | ||
1865bc71 BP |
88 | AMD CPUs up to and excluding family 0x17 provide for Memory |
89 | Error Injection into the ECC detection circuits. The amd64_edac | |
90 | module allows the operator/user to inject Uncorrectable and | |
91 | Correctable errors into DRAM. | |
7d6034d3 DT |
92 | |
93 | When enabled, in each of the respective memory controller directories | |
94 | (/sys/devices/system/edac/mc/mcX), there are 3 input files: | |
95 | ||
96 | - inject_section (0..3, 16-byte section of 64-byte cacheline), | |
97 | - inject_word (0..8, 16-bit word of 16-byte section), | |
98 | - inject_ecc_vector (hex ecc vector: select bits of inject word) | |
99 | ||
100 | In addition, there are two control files, inject_read and inject_write, | |
101 | which trigger the DRAM ECC Read and Write respectively. | |
